Transaction ff0588390c3e31c22ef46fb5a50b53bce9769e382df98b95e66b51f4c4fd0369

1 Input
2 Outputs
  • ff0588390c3e31c22ef46fb5a50b53bce9769e382df98b95e66b51f4c4fd0369:0
  • value  130000000
    address  msBFpKRysRUPKAmCjzU2Gc7twXpfwXWCKR
  • ff0588390c3e31c22ef46fb5a50b53bce9769e382df98b95e66b51f4c4fd0369:1
  • value  3240907915
    address  2N7CSFLozqZot6G4ByzqcvjR72VZKCUbGJ2